## Step 4: Enable banker's rounding

Tollgate's legacy converter truncated sub-cent amounts, producing drift on high-volume currency pairs. This step switches the conversion service to banker's rounding with explicit precision per currency. Restart the converter after applying; reconciliation jobs will flag any remaining mismatches within one cycle. Apply the following configuration values before restarting.

settings of fafog-haduf:
ZORIX_PIN=4648
ZORIX_METRICS_HOST=metrics.zorix.paliqsys.corp
ZORIX_LOG_LEVEL=info
ZORIX_TENANT=druix

Handover — Quillbus broker upgrade

Welcome aboard. We're moving the Quillbus cluster at Verrow Systems from 3.9 to 4.2. Drain each node before stopping it, confirm queue mirroring in the Larkspur dashboard, and never upgrade two nodes in the same zone at once. Marta left runbooks in the ops wiki. If the cluster loses quorum mid-upgrade, you'll need the recovery passphrase to unseal the config store.

unlock words, tawif-tahop: oliys-ulawyn-tamdor-lamys-casox-jormir-fraius-kasath-ulador-ulamir-holir-sorys-holeth

## Service Accounts: Breakerbox

Breakerbox is our circuit breaker sitting in front of the flaky Quillstream upstream API. When Quillstream starts timing out, Breakerbox trips and serves cached responses so nobody pages at 3 a.m. New folks: the breaker itself runs under the svc-breakerbox account. It authenticates to the internal trip-state store using the key below.

service key, fawip-bajef: kto11_Qt5wZK9vdNC

INTERNAL MEMO — Heads of Department

Subject: Expansion into the Tarravale Region

Brevik Foods will open its first Tarravale distribution hub in Q3, anchored by the Northgate facility. Department heads should plan for phased staffing, local supplier onboarding, and a three-month pilot of the Larkspur delivery routes. Capital spend is approved; operating budgets follow in the next cycle. Marlowe Dent will coordinate cross-functional timelines. The strategic context for this move is set out in the note below.

board note of fahag-tajop: The eastern region missed its Julix quota by 44.0 percent last quarter. Ralionax Holdings plans to lower the Druath list price by 61.8 percent in March. The board signed off on a budget of $295.0 million for Project Gilath. The renewal with Ruswynix Systems closes at $274.5 million a year, 17.0 percent above the last contract.